Hike Log

Wilson Mountain

Trailhead:

Trail 123 North Wilson

Type of Hike:

Day hike

Trail Conditions:

Trail in good condition

ROAD:

Road suitable for all vehicles

Bugs:

Bugs were not too bad

Snow:

Snow free

A cool spring morning was a great start for this trail. The first two miles or so are the most technical with some steep switchbacks and lots of loose rock. I highly recommend poles. Once through this stretch, the trail levels out and continues up to the top with lightly sloped switchbacks. The views are truly OUTSTANDING with lush forest to the north and red rock canyon to the south. Absolutely lovely. Next time we will go up from the bridge but will definitely be going back for those spectacular views again.
